Homemade Granola Recipe
Ingredients:
4 cup Uncooked quick oatmeal
1 cup Chopped peanuts (no skins)
1/2 cup Grape Nuts
1/2 cup Bran
1/4 cup Granulated sugar substitute
1/3 cup Vegetable oil
1/2 cup Wheat germ
1/2 cup Raisins
Preparation:
Spread the oatmeal on a cookie sheet and heat in a 350 F oven for 10
minutes. Combine all but the wheat germ and raisins. Bake on an
ungreased cookie sheet or pan for 20 minutes, stirring once to brown
evenly.
Allow mixture to cook (?) in the oven. Add wheat germ and raisins.
Refrigerate in glass jars or plastic containers. 6 1/2 cups.
1/4 cup serving = 140 calories, 1 starch/bread, 1 fat exchange 15
grams carbohydrate, 5 grams protein, 7 grams fat, 57 mg sodium
